Prayer Leader Guide
This is a guide / refresher on Prayer Leading.
Prayer Leading, as you probably already know, is the job of "leading" the group through "prayer."
That's pretty straight forward. Right?!
Parts of the Worship :
1. Prayer to Take Authority - Makes it so that the room we're in is a holy space and should be treated as such. It is also asking the Lord for protection, taking command of the spirits in the room. Also, we invoke the name of Jesus and the help of Mama Mary! Please have someone set to read this. INVOKING THE NAME OF JESUS & MAMA MARY.
2. Opening Prayer - The prayer in which we begin the worship. We ask God to keep us focused on the worship, to let everything go smoothly, to bless us, etc. Also, we pray that we may leave the world behind for a while and be here for Him and Him alone. This prayer set's the tone of the worship.
3. Holy Spirit - The prayer in which we ask the Holy Spirit to come down upon us. We pray that the Holy Spirit guide us during this worship and allow / help us to hear his word and put it to action.
4. Adoration - The prayer in which we say "I love you, Lord!". Not be confused with High Praise. (It's easier to explain in person. Please call or ask about this one. Sorry!)
5. Readings - The word of God! VERY IMPORTANT. Please have someone set to read these. NOTE: You, the prayer leader(s), don't HAVE to do that. You can read it on your own. Leader always does the gospel though.
6. Reflections - See help with reflections. If possible, Prayer Leaders should have one prepared.
7. Contrition - The prayer in which we ask the Lord to forgive our faults and failings. While we DO ask for forgiveness, we also ask for the strength to do better next time.
8. Love Offering - The prayer in which we ask God to take what we have to offer him. We give him our time, work, abilities, etc.(not necessarily money) Even if it's not much, we ask that he take what we give and make it beautiful for his purposes.
9. Thanksgiving - The prayer in which we thank God for all the gifts and blessing! Pretty straight forward! :)
10. Supplication - The prayer in which we exult Jesus. We say how great he is. How powerful he is. Not to be confused with adoration.
11. High Praise - The prayer in which we exult Jesus. We say how great he is. How powerful he is. How wonderful. How beautiful in everyday. This is all about HIM! No "us" involved. Not to be confused with Adoration. (It's easier to explain in person. Please call or ask about this one. Sorry!)
